Career Path

The Certificate in Indigenous Language Revitalization: Best Practices program equips learners with the skills to revitalize and teach indigenous languages. The growing demand for professionals in this field reflects the increasing recognition of the importance of preserving indigenous cultures and languages. Language Teacher (60%): Individuals with this skill set are in high demand, as schools and communities work to integrate indigenous languages into their curriculum. Curriculum Developer (20%): Curriculum developers play a crucial role in designing and implementing effective language learning programs tailored to the unique needs of indigenous communities. Language Researcher (10%): Language researchers contribute to the preservation of indigenous languages by studying their structure, usage, and cultural significance. Community Outreach Coordinator (10%): Community outreach coordinators facilitate connections between language programs and the communities they serve, ensuring the relevance and accessibility of language revitalization initiatives.
